Abstract

Provided is an ice avalanche-type glacial lake outburst surge generation and height measurement device. A glacial lake outburst test device includes a glacial lake simulation module and an ice avalanche surge module. An impact path, an impact angle, an impact scale, an impact velocity and a landslide density of an ice avalanche slider are controlled by simulation means. During formation of ice avalanche surges, the ice avalanche slider rushes into the glacial lake at a high speed, an ice avalanche pushes water to move in a sliding direction, thus forming a first surge, then continues to move to the bottom of the lake under the inertia and discharges a certain amount of water at its back. Movement of the landslide drives surrounding water to converge quickly into the back area, thus forming a second surge. Surge waves evolve around with a water entry point as a center.
